Infiltration Lens is useful for infect since the opponent often tries to avoid getting counters altogether (thank you proliferate) and will want to block. Abusing that fear can get you some nice card advantage early on, and help keep cards in your hand later in the game.

Shoot, forgot my main point... Graft doesn't work on Force of Savagery. It has to enter play first, then a counter can be moved onto it (it's triggered ability and the Force can only survive with static abilities or state-based effects).

Think of something like Door of Destinies (elemental creature types) and then use power conduit to move counters to it, or Chorus of the conclave, or spidersilk armor, or Gaea's Anthem... Something like that :-)
